So maybe all this post has done is to prove that I can't post text that looks like real http tags into this forum. The "You don't have permission to access /editpost.php on this server." is somewhat unhelpful though.
Anyway, the upshot is that I consistently get the message that there was an error processing my request for www.linuxtoday.com. If I use curl with a -v flag I can see a valid-looking certificate come back immediately, and then after about a 10 second pause is the HTTP error message. I think the certificate is being issued by a reverse proxy, and the reverse proxy is unable to get any response from the web service behind it.
